What percent of the June budget was for Tim's Chevron and car (to the nearest tenth)?

Answer:

17.4% of the June budget was for Tim's Chevron and car.

Explanation:

Consider the provided information.

Now consider the table shown in figure.

The total budget of June is $1695.

The sum of Tim's Chevron and Car is:

$23 + $272 = $295

Now we need to find the percent of the June budget was for Tim's Chevron and car.

The percentage can be calculated as:


(Part)/(Whole)=(Percent)/(100)


(295)/(1695)=(Percent)/(100)


Percent=(295)/(1695)* 100


Percent=17.40

Hence, 17.4% of the June budget was for Tim's Chevron and car.
